[quote=Dogboy]The top skin of the deck is 1/8” thick max. The foam core is roughly 3/8” thick. Then the inner layer is only a few plies of glass, 1/16” thick or less. My recommendation when drilling the deck for injection, put a stop or at the very least, a piece of masking tape on your drill bit to limit the depth to 1/4” so you only go thru the outer glass layer. It is very easy to punch all the way thru the deck with a power drill and then you just gave yourself a big headache since you will have to plug that hole before injecting or all the resin will just drop down into the hull.
After you drill all your initial 1/4” deep holes, remove the stop from the bit and take the bit out of the drill. Then just put the bit into the hole and spin it by hand (with your fingers) so the hole goes down to the inner layer of glass but not thru. Suck all the foam bits out of the holes with a shop vac.
I also recommend masking off the entire are that you are injecting before drilling the holes. This will give you a surface to mark out before you start drilling and it will also prevent epoxy from getting all over the deck and into the nonskid.
